What companies run services between Luton Hoo, England and Stevenage, England?

Centrebus operates a bus from Chiltern Green Road to Stevenage station 4 times a day. Tickets cost £2–4 and the journey takes 35 min.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Luton Hoo to Stevenage via Bull Wood, Luton Airport Parkway Rail Station, Luton Airport Parkway, and London St Pancras Intl in around 1h 38m.
